Abstract

PURPOSE:To put a fabric at a specified location under a neatly spread condition after carrying by separating and carrying assuredly stacked fabrics one by one. CONSTITUTION:This separating/carrying device for fabrics consists of a machine bed 1, a fabric gripping means 3 to grip fabrics being stacked on a fabric loading table 8 which is vertically movably provided on the machine bed 1, a fabric separating means 4 to separate a fabric which is about to be gripped and lifted by the fabric gripping means 3 from other fabrics, a carrying means for the fabric gripped by the fabric gripping means 3, a fabric arranging means which puts the fabric being carried at a specified location neatly, and an electronic control device.

BACKGROUND OF THE INVENTION 1. Field of the Invention The present invention relates to a cloth peeling / conveying device for peeling and stacking stacked fabrics one by one in a process after cutting a raw fabric.

Description of the Related Art Conventionally, when the uppermost one of the piled fabrics is grasped and lifted, the first and second fabrics cannot be properly separated from each other, and only one place near the center of the fabric can be separated. When gripping and lifting, the peripheral edge of the fabric hangs down, and it is not possible to lower the fabric in a properly spread state at the post-conveyance position.Therefore, use two or more gripping members to grip the topmost piece of fabric. The end portion of the cloth was gripped at two or four points and conveyed.

When the end portion of the cloth is gripped and conveyed, a plurality of gripping members interfere with the sewing machine or the like in the next step where a sewing machine or the like is used, and two or more cloth gripping members are required. Therefore, there is a problem that the control mechanism of the gripping member becomes complicated and the cost also increases.

By turning on the switch of the electric circuit for operating the entire cloth gripping and conveying device, the cloth stacking table on which the cloths are piled up has a predetermined height depending on the operation of the motor and the signal from the stop position sensor of the cloth stacking table. Stop in position
The cloth gripping member moves onto the vicinity of the central portion of the cloths stacked on the cloth placing table by the operation of the front-back movement cylinder and the left-right movement cylinder.

The fabric placing table on which the fabrics are stacked is raised by the operation of the motor and stopped at a predetermined position. This stop position is a position where the uppermost front end of the raised fabric is lightly pressed by the fabric pressing member. When the cloth placing table is stopped, the cloth gripping member attached to the tip of the vertical movement cylinder descends and grips the uppermost piece of cloth stacked on the cloth placing table.

The roller of the cloth pressing member is pressing near the front end of the cloth, and the cloth gripping member grips almost the center of the cloth and starts rising, and then the cloth gripping member is lifted at approximately the midpoint of the lifting stroke. Stops once. Then, when the cloth gripping member is once stopped, compressed air is jetted between the two rollers of the cloth pressing member. The top fabric is
Since the front ends of the two rollers are pressed and the central portion of the cloth is gripped and lifted by the cloth gripping member, the uppermost cloth lightly pressed by the two rollers is gripped and lifted by the cloth gripping member. Occasionally, the fabric will rise slightly between the two rollers. Then, compressed air is blown from the air jet nozzle to the raised portion, the uppermost fabric and the second fabric are separated by this air, and only the uppermost first fabric is separated and conveyed. .

By the movement of the forward and backward movement cylinders and the left and right movement cylinders, the cloth gripping member grips the cloth, reaches the upper part of the cloth holder, and moves up and down by the operation of the vertical movement cylinder,
The guide member moves the fabric splashing member to the front of the fabric gripping member, but when the vertical movement cylinder is raised to the uppermost point, the fabric splashing member is moved below the fabric gripping member.

In the process of lowering the vertically moving cylinder while moving in the conveying direction, the cloth flip-up member moves to the front of the cloth gripping member, grips the vicinity of the center of the cloth and grips the portion of the cloth hanging in the conveying direction, that is, the front. By flipping up the cloth with the cloth flip-up member, the cloth can be placed on the cloth holder without any bent portion.
